PARAPHRASE TELEGRAM from the Governor of Hong Kong to
the Secretary of State for the Colonies.
Dated 8th March
(Received Colonial Office 5.40 p.m. 8th April 1922)
He
Offer is highly appreciated by Fletcher.
feels compelled however to request to beallowed not
to accept it. Almost the whole of his training and
?experience has been in the Secretariat; and although
he has acted as Treasurer for one year he feels some
doubts as to his ability to handle such large financial problems as seem likely to ?arise in Palestine.
Moreover at the present rate of exchange of the dollar his pay on the sliding scale plus allowance as Clerk
of the Councils is now equivalent to £1875 per annum. Acceptance of the post in Palestine would therefore
involve an actual immediate loss, as well as loss in pension and loss of prospective acting pay as Colonial Secretary. I desire to add that owing to the political
situation in Canton, I foresee that there will be a very difficult and critical period ahead and I consider that his transfer from Hong Kong at this time would be a very serious loss to the Colony. I earnestly hope that when the post of Colonial Secretary here falls vacant in a few years time you will appoint him to that post. I do not think I am mistaken in stating that he would prefer that post to any other in the Colonial Service. Your telegram of the 4th of April refere.
STUBBS
